Saibot: A Differentially Private Data Search Platform

Summary: Saibot enables differentially private task-based dataset search by privatizing reusable factorized semiring statistics once, avoiding budget exhaustion from repeated ML evaluations. Specialized join sensitivity and noise allocation retain 50–90% of nonprivate search accuracy. (summarized by gpt-5.6-luna on Jul 24 2026)
